Job Description

Insight Global is looking for a Principal Software/Firmware Engineer to join one of our Fortune 200 clients in the Richmond area for a full-time position. In this role you will be:
* Developing internal infrastructure and implementing strategies to ensure current and future software engineering needs are satisfied to support development of inhalable product platforms.
* Leading embedded software and firmware development for innovative inhalable devices to meet design requirements and ensure system level integration.
* Serving as software/firmware system design authority.
* Leading technical discussions and problem solving for software projects and collaborating with platform and system architects on the impacts of design decisions.
* Building and leading a team of software engineers (internal resources and external design partners) on software engineering methodologies and new technologies; reviewing designs and architectures of the product development team.
* Serving as company SME for software/firmware activities and initiatives.
* Leading the development, integration and testing of firmware modules for various core device technologies in collaboration with internal and external partners.
* Crafting a roadmap for firmware modules to accelerate the prototype development and leading the development plan for these modules, including the firmware aspect of new technology and effective implementation of the roadmap.

Required Skills & Experience

* Bachelor's degree required (Software Engineering or related field).
* 10+ years of relevant experience in design, engineering and testing of embedded software for electronic products.
* Experience building and leading internal/external software teams and implementing software engineering standard methodologies for embedded software development.
* Firmware design experience across the full product lifecycle within multi-disciplinary teams in industries such as small consumer electronics, automotive electronics, medical device manufacturers/ scientific instrument manufacturers and lab automation product or service providers
* Experience in Software and Firmware development of embedded applications, with solid experience with low-level C (drivers and RTOS), Python programming and technical project management using Agile practices
* Ability to establish the relationships, infrastructure and build effective partnerships with external suppliers to expand Software/Firmware capabilities
* Strong oral and written communication skills are required. Must have the ability to deliver effective formal presentations to senior management.
* Demonstrated ability to take a hands-on role in software development and to work closely with the team to diagnose and solve complex challenges.
* Experience developing software products within a regulated or high assurance environment and familiarity with the tools and processes needed to ensure design quality and traceability.
